Re: Last Years game vs. This year's Game

I liked this year. I love the 3v3, and the wide open strategies. Plus, even despite having an amazing HP last year, I still didnt like that the robot couldnt score the primary scoring objects.
This years field was also a lot more open, which made for faster paced, exiting action, versus the bottlenecks whichs formed in the middle last year. This year was simpler in terms of robot functions, but that led to teams focusing on doing one thing, and doing it well, so you saw some amazing arms. Plus this year's autonomous crushed last years, it had a LOT more options. Last year all you could do was knock the balls off, or hang in the case of a couple teams. This year there were the vision tetras, the auto loaders, the 1 starting tetra per alliance, and the magnetic tetras.
